才信息后,向心仪的企业发简历。企业的人力资源部对这些求职者的简历进行分析处理,筛选选择,最后公布出录用人员的名单,并通知未被录取人员,人力资源部也将录取人员的培训及职位安排部署给各个所需人才的部门。整个业务到此为止。 1.3 新系统数据流程及数据字典设计
1. 数据流程图,如下所示:
简历 大学生 P0.0 审核处理 顶层数据流程图 录用信 息 大学生 简历 大学生 P1.0 录入处理 录用信 息 学生个人简历 筛选处 理 查询录用情 况 修改更新数 据 P3.0 修改更 新处理 P2.0 筛选处理 不合格信 息 P2.1 查询 合格信 息 合格信 息 不合格学生简历 合格学生简历 不合格信 息 P2.2 删除处理 图4-系统流程图
6
2. 数据字典
1).数据项定义 数据项编号:I01-02 数据项名称:大学生简历编号 简述:A企业面试学生简历的编号 类型及宽度:字符型,5位
2).数据结构定义
3).数据流定义
4).处理逻辑定义
取值范围:“00001~99999” 数据结构编号:DS03-01
数据结构名称:大学生简历审核信息
简述:大学生简历录入信息(DS-01),筛选信息(DS-02)
和修改更新信息(DS-03)等
数据结构组成:DS-01+DS-02+DS-03 数据流编号:D
数据流名称:简历信息,录用信息,筛选处理,合格与不
合格信息等
简述:学生写的简历表 数据流来源:大学生
数据流去向:人力资源部,企业各部门
数据流组成:简历编号+简历表+录用信息表 数据流量:10份/时
高峰流量:20份/时(上午9:00——11:00) 处理逻辑定义:仅对数据流程图中最底
层的处理逻辑加以说明
处理逻辑编号:P1.0
7
处理逻辑名称:录入处理
简述:人事部门人员对大学生简历的基本信息处理
输入的数据流:简历信息 处 理:简历处理 输出的数据流:简历总表
5). 数据存储定义
6). 外部实体的定义
数据存储定义: 数据存储在数据字典中之描述数
据的逻辑存储结构,而不涉及它的物理组织。
数据存储编号:F01-F03
数据存储名称:学生个人简历,合格学生简历,不合格学生简历
简 述:记录学生的简历录入情况信息等
数据存储组成:投简历时间+投简历者情况 关键字:简历情况
相关联的处理:F01+F02+F03 外部实体的定义包括:外部实体编号,名称,简述,
及有关数据流的输出与输入。
外部实体编号:S01-S02 外部实体名称:大学生, 简 述:对大学生的简历进行审核 输入的数据流:投递的简历 输出的数据流:录入情况
8
1.4 新系统功能结构设计 1. 系统总体设计
企业面试学生简历管理系统 信息录入维护信息查询 信息删除 生个学人信息表维护 学生成绩表维护 个人实习信息表维护 各部门人才需求表维护 学生个人信息查询 学生成绩查询 个人实习信息查询 各部门人才需求查询 未被录用大学生简历的删除 图5-总体功能图 从图5总体功能图可以看出写字楼的各项功能,把写字楼的基本内容都包括了进来,写字楼系统包括5个大的功能,这5个功能又包含了各自小功能模块,这样细分为开发系统和实施做好准备及提供了方便。
9
2系统设计(执笔:)
2.1 代码设计
代码是代表事物名称、属性、状态等的符号。 信息编码一般应遵循一下原则:
(1)唯一性:唯一地标识要处理的对象是编制代码的首要任务。 (2)规范性:编码的规范化是实现信息分类、汇总、统计的基础。
(3)柔性:即编码应有一定的灵活性,当系统中增加对象、删除对象时,能保持其编码规则不变。
(4)兼容性:即与相关信息编码体系间的协调性。
(5)简短性:编码应在满足汇总要求的情况下尽可能短,以便于节省存储空间,减少冗余。
(6)可识别性:代码应尽可能反映对象的特性,以助记忆和便于了解与使用。
在设计新系统一方面为了统一产品的品种、特性及其不同的供应商,另一方面为了方便数据的输入,所以对每个零件设计了代码。具体如下:
如此一来遵循以上这些原则为公司及其内部员工进行编号如下:
公司编号 岗 位 编 号 会计:1 理财顾问:2 软件开发人员:3 营销人员:4 工程师:5 公司:1
10